Partially open the bonnet, lift the safety

catch and raise the bonnet.

Secure the stay in one of the two notches,

according to the height required, to hold the

bonnet open.

Lift the cover at the foot of the left-hand

seat and pull the release lever upwards.

At the front, unclip the cover by pressing it

at the bottom.
At the rear, unclip the cover using a coin or

the flat part of the towing eye.

Take care when working under the bonnet.
Refer to "Levels" in section 6 for advice on use of the fluids.

DRIVING SAFELY

Cruise control / Speed limiter

51, 54

For the cruise control, he vehicle speed must be

higher than 25 mph (40 km/h) with at least 4th

gear engaged
For the speed limiter, the minimum vehicle speed

that can be programmed is 20 mph (30 km/h).

98

Grip control

This allows the vehicle to make progress in

most conditions of low grip.
